Curio is a bar and restaurant that honors all things unconventional. Located next to The Chapel, the Mission’s most prominent performance venue, the space brings together some of life’s greatest pleasures – well-crafted cocktails, regional American food, and live music. The eclectic space draws inspiration from the building’s past as a mortuary, exploring the mysterious themes of life and time.

  • Parking details
    Aside from metered street parking (enforcement ending at 6pm), there is no parking provided onsite. There are parking garages located in the neighborhood. One is the Mission & Bartlett Garage at 90 Bartlett St. (between 21st and 22nd Streets). Another is the Hoff Street Garage at 42 Hoff (between 16th and 17th Streets).
  • Public transit
    The closest BART station is 16th & Mission, approximately a 10 minute walk from us. SF Muni bus lines 14, 22, 33, 49, and the J CHURCH light rail are all within walking distance. There are also All Nighter bus routes available throughout the city and surrounding counties.
